Why It's Important to Have Your Double Glazed Windows Repaired

Double glazing can cause issues over time. This can include condensation between the panes and fog that blocks the view or obscuring sunlight.

Fortunately, the majority of these issues can be addressed without the expense of replacement windows. If you're looking to save money on energy bills or improving the resale value of your home, fixing your double glazing is worth the expense.

Panes damaged Panes

A double pane window consists of two glass panels with an insulating space between them. The space is usually filled with an inert gas, like argon or Krypton, to slow the passage of heat through the window. This improves the efficiency of energy. If one of the glass panes is damaged, it's important to get a professional to fix the damage as soon as possible to avoid further hazards from weather conditions and other hazards.

If a double-pane window gets foggy, it means the seal between the panes has broken. This can be caused by a number of factors, including direct sunlight or extreme temperature fluctuations. Once the seal breaks it allows moisture to enter and eventually forms condensation. This could make it difficult to see through the window and may cause damage inside the frame.

To correct the issue it is necessary to remove the old sealant from the edges of the window. To remove the caulking and adhesive, you will need a putty or scraper. You can use a heating gun or hairdryer to soften the sealant but be careful not to overheat the frame or glass. Once the old adhesive is gone, you can put a new caulk around the edges of the window.

You can also try a defogging process that involves running water or a different vapor across the inside of the window to eliminate any condensation. This method is mixed in reviews, however, and might not be able to make the window's insulation return to its original value. In most instances, it is best to replace the damaged glass pane by a brand new one from an expert company.

As double pane windows are custom made for your home, you'll require an expert in window design to assist you in replacing the glass. They'll take the frame that you have and take measurements to ensure you get the right size of glass. They'll then replace damaged glass and make sure that everything is airtight and sealed. They'll also provide a warranty to ensure that you're satisfied with their work.

Condensation

If you notice condensation developing between the panes of your double-glazing, it can be quite an irritating issue. This is because the moisture could indicate that heat is escaping from your home. In the long run, it can be very expensive to fix. There are a few steps you can take to reduce the formation of condensation. These include regular cleaning and ventilation. Open windows and doors whenever possible to let air circulate. Using extractor fans in kitchens and bathrooms will also be helpful. Ventilation can help stop condensation from the kitchen and bathroom. It is caused by moisture and if it is not able to escape it will form on surfaces such as mirrors, double glazing and glass.

Condensation of double glazing is usually due to problems with the "spacer bar' that sits between each window pane. It is typically filled with desiccant which is a highly-absorbtive material that sucks up any moisture that may be trapped in the 'air gap' between the windows. The seal can become saturated if it is inadequate. In the end, this moisture will then appear as condensation between the window panes.


In the event of extreme condensation, it might be necessary for the sealed unit to be completely replaced. A professional should be consulted to ensure that the procedure is done correctly. The technician will employ drills to eliminate the excess moisture, and then seal the holes completely or apply an anti-fog coating to allow air to flow.

If your double glazing is under warranty, you must contact the company that installed it as they will be able to solve the issue at no charge. If you cannot find an organization that can repair your double glazing then you'll need to search for a reputable company that can repair the unit at a reasonable cost. This is generally the cheapest way to fix this type of condensation. In many cases, it's more effective than replacing the entire window.

Draughts

Double glazing helps you reduce your energy costs by keeping warm air inside your home and cold air out. However, over time it could develop issues requiring repairs. This could mean you need to replace your windows. This will make your home as energy efficient as possible, and comfortable.

Condensation and damaged seals could create drafts. You should check that the frame is intact and that there aren't any chips or cracks have developed. If you notice a draught, it could be an indicator that the seal around the window has broken down, meaning that cold air is penetrating into your home. This could result in an increase in heating costs and could be extremely uncomfortable.

If you own UPVC windows, it is important to maintain them regularly to prevent draughts from developing. If you do not oil the hinges regularly they will start to stiffen, which can create a gap through which air can escape. Another common cause of draughts is because the window sash is falling and this can cause discomfort and loss of effectiveness.

If you spot a draft, it's essential to contact a double glazing repair service as quickly as possible. This will ensure that they're able to fix the problem. The repair service will help you identify the cause of the draught and replace any damaged or worn out parts. In some instances, the work required to repair the problem may be as easy as filling any gaps between the frame and the wall.

Glass that is smudges could also mean that the double glazing is no longer working effectively and that it needs replacing. In this instance you can decide to replace the entire window or only the sealed units. You can also upgrade to energy efficient windows with A-rated ratings by replacing your old windows. This will enhance their performance and allow you to reduce your energy costs.

A broken window lock is another issue that can arise with double glazing. This is a serious threat to security that could leave your home vulnerable to burglars. It could also make insurance policies invalid. You should choose a reputable business to fix your double glazing to ensure that you can be confident about the security of your home.

Security

Double-glazing is an excellent way to lower your energy bills by preventing hot air from exiting from the building and cold air coming in. It also helps to reduce noise levels, especially when you live in a busy area or near the motorway.

However, over time double glazing can begin to exhibit issues. It could be that the doors or the windows become stiff, allow drafts to enter the home or fail to close properly. In some cases, these problems can be fixed without the need to replace the entire unit.

First of all, it is recommended to seek out the help from an expert because they will be able to identify the problem and resolve it swiftly. This will stop the issue from becoming worse and you will save time and stress. A window or door that is difficult to open can be fixed by simply cooling it down and applying grease. This will remove any stiffness that is present in the lock mechanism or handle. If this doesn't work, it may be time to replace the locking mechanisms or handles altogether.

Condensation between glass panes is another common problem. This occurs because the gases that insulate the glass are diminished. The moisture from the atmosphere then seeps through the gap. This is an normal process that will occur over time. However, you can prevent it by regularly cleaning your windows and using a condensate cleanser.

Older double-glazed windows will often have large gaps between the frames and leaves that could allow rainwater to enter the property and loss of heat. This is a sign that the seals are failing and it is the time to purchase an upgraded, new model of windows that will provide better insulation and lower energy costs.

Double-glazed windows and doors are very difficult to break into and can act as an effective deterrent to burglars. However, it is essential to think about upgrading your locks to a higher quality, as they will be more resistant to attempts at forced entry.
